Victor matrix BVE-49226. L. & W. R. R. station in Kentucky / Frank Crumit

TitleSource
L. & W. R. R. station in Kentucky (Primary title)Victor ledgers
Authors and ComposersNotes
Frank Crumit (composer)
PersonnelNotes Hide Additional Titles
Frank Crumit (vocalist : tenor vocal)
Carson Robison (instrumentalist : guitar)
  • Description: Male vocal solo, with guitar and traps
  • Category: Vocal
  • Language: English
  • Master Size: 10-in.
Notes
Source(s): Victor ledgers.
Victor ledgers: "On approval."
Victor ledgers show accompanists as Robison and an unnamed trapman (probably William Reitz).
Take Date and PlaceTakeStatusLabel Name/NumberFormatNote Hide Additional Titles
12/4/1928 New York, New York 1 Hold
12/4/1928 New York, New York 2 Master/hold
